Gorki
Gorki Golf Club is home to a well-rated open parkland layout. The course is located a 90-minute drive from St Petersburg in a rural environment of open fields and woodland. Course description, images and other details to follow soon.
Visitors welcome on weekdays and weekends during the golf season (May thru' Oct).
Must book in advance.
Russia's 2nd best course (Golf Digest, 2022).
